"The River House"
Nestled on the banks of the Ahnapee River, this delightful main floor duplex offers everything for your next Algoma and Door County adventure. A great mix of sleeping arrangements to accommodate all your guests needs. Featuring a well-equipped kitchen and an attached bonus sunroom with stunning 180 degree water views (plus, a comfy sofa bed). Perfect for a relaxing getaway, fishing charter, or a trip to Lambeau Field. Easy access to some of the areas best fishing directly off the dock. Some additional amenities include free high speed WiFi, AC, fire pit, smart TVs, and onsite laundry during your stay. Your own boat slip is reserved for the duration of your stay, overnight docking is permitted and encouraged. Fish right off the dock or have instant access to your boat.
We are located close to Algoma’s winery, brewery, picturesque Crescent Beach, unique restaurants and art galleries. A great place to call home while you're away. We hope you enjoy your stay!

Be aware there is no overnight street parking - Nov 1 to March 31 on any city street between 2am and 5am. During the summer season, there is plenty of vehicle parking across the street on the road. Please obey all posted street signs. Parking in front of the house is not permitted (it is a turning zone). From April 1 thru October 31, there is no parking of vehicles on lawns. Additionally, you can not park any type of trailer (including boat trailers) or motor homes for more than 48 hours on city streets. Trailer parking is available at Algoma Marina.
Please do not clean your fish inside the house. A cleaning station has been provided and is located right off the docks. It has running water and a drain. Please dispose of waste appropriately. Please follow Wisconsin DNR recommendations for responsible fish disposal. Fish waste, including guts, can be recycled at Algoma Marina. Dumping of fish waste in the river is a finable offense.
Due to the unpredictability of the river, children should not be left unsupervised outdoors. Life jackets should be worn at all times. Docks/slips can be unsteady, please enjoy them responsibly and safely. The shoreline is protected by riprap. For your safety, please do not climb on the rocks.
